Abstract
The invention discloses a device detecting the quantity of oil in an oil tank. The device comprises a power adapter and is characterized by further comprising a main processor, a pressure sensor and a signal transceiver, wherein the main processor is connected with the power adaptor, and the pressure sensor and the signal transceiver are connected with the main processor; the pressure sensor is arranged at the bottom of the oil tank. The device has the advantages of being simple in structure, capable of effectively detecting the quantity of the residual oil in the oil tank, and high in applicability.

Background technology
Fuel-quantity transducer principle is mainly by the resistance in fuel-quantity transducer inner installation reluctance switch and various different resistances at present.When in automotive oil tank, oil level changes, fuel-quantity transducer float is opened the reluctance switch of differing heights.Fuel-quantity transducer is the different internal resistance reflection automobile Fuel Remained volume percent of output externally.If fuel tank volume, shape are changed, need redesign build-out resistor according to fuel tank volume and the respective function of height, complex process and cost are higher.
Summary of the invention
The object of the invention is the deficiency existing in order to solve above-mentioned background technology, propose a kind of simple in structure, can effectively detect mailbox Fuel Oil Remaining, fuel tank fuel quantity pick-up unit that applicability is wide.
In order to realize above object, a kind of fuel tank fuel quantity pick-up unit provided by the invention, comprises power supply adaptor, it is characterized in that: also comprise the primary processor being connected with power supply adaptor, the pressure transducer being connected with primary processor and signal transceiver; Described pressure transducer is located on the inwall of fuel tank bottom.
Beneficial effect of the present invention: one, owing to adopting the structure that pressure transducer is set on the inwall of fuel tank bottom, carry out computed altitude by liquid pressure, in fuel tank, Fuel Oil Remaining, only in highly relevant, calculates convenient; Its two, adopt a pressure transducer to replace multiple resistance, structure is more simple, applicability is stronger.

Embodiment: as shown in Figure 1, a kind of fuel tank fuel quantity pick-up unit that the present invention is designed, comprises power supply adaptor 1, it is characterized in that: also comprise the primary processor 2 being connected with power supply adaptor 1, the pressure transducer 3 being connected with primary processor 2 and signal transceiver 4; Described pressure transducer 3 is located on the inwall of fuel tank bottom.
According to formula:
P = ρgh (1)
In formula (1), P is that pressure transducer 3 is at the suffered pressure of mounting points; ρ is fluid to be measured density; G is acceleration of gravity; H is the vertical range of sensor to the water surface.The pressure that known pressure transducer 3 is subject to is relevant with the height of the density of liquid, acceleration of gravity, liquid level.In the time of actual measurement, P is actually atmospheric pressure and liquid level pressure sum, that is:
P = P
0+ ρgh (2)
Have:
P - P
0 = ρgh (3)
Formula (3) illustrates the poor of 3 actual total pressures that are subject to for pressure transducer 3 of suffered liquid pressure of pressure transducer and atmospheric pressure.Can obtain thus:
h=( P- P
0) /ρg (4)
When fuel level in tank changes, can calculate according to formula (4) height of oil level.
In primary processor 2, input the level height of this fuel tank and the funtcional relationship of fuel oil volume, corresponding the level height detecting fuel oil volume, do data processing with software.Output signal to panel board, oil mass information is presented on panel board.
During at every turn to new fuel tank coupling, fuel oil height and Fuel Remained volumetric parameter are demarcated, and need not be changed hardware, reach unitized object.
